Working with a doctor to find relief is important, since untreated dry mouth can lead to bad breath, tooth decay and gum disease, and other unpleasant cpap side effects. Experiencing dry mouth from using a cpap machine can be uncomfortable, but there are strategies to help mitigate this issue. Cpap dry mouth is where the influx of air administered from your cpap machine causes the mucus membrane known as oral mucosa in your mouth and throat to dry out. Here's how you can stop a dry mouth. Waking up with a dry mouth is a common cpap therapy side effect, caused by air leaks, mouth breathing and decreased saliva flow. To combat dry mouth, you should ensure a proper mask fit, raise your humidity settings, try heated cpap. Roughly 40% of patients on cpap therapy experience dry mouth, 1 which can cause various side effects including headaches, dizziness, bad breath, coughing and difficulty talking or eating.
